E-Sports in Education

In 2020, British eSports and Pearson collaborated to launch the very first eSports BTEC qualification; this has been a huge success. Currently, over 1,800 students are already studying the BTEC in 70 locations throughout the UK. There are only a few courses available, but as the business becomes more popular, more courses will become available.

How Many People Play E-sports?

Using the standards of Newzoo, there was a 12.3% growth from 2018 to 2019 on an annual basis. According to Newzoo’s 2019 statistics, there were 197 million eSports fans and 200.8 million occasional watchers, making a total of 397.8 million. However, by 2020, it had increased to 220.5 million infrequent viewers and 215.4 million fans, making a combined audience of 435.9 million.

According to Newzoo, the Compound Annual Growth Rate (CAGR) for fans of ESports from 2019 to 2024 is predicted to be about 7.7%. They anticipate a rise in occasional viewers to 291.6 million. In addition, there will be 285.7 million eSports fans, bringing the viewership size to 577.2 million. The rising markets are mainly in the Middle East, Africa, Asia-Pacific, and Latin America. The demand has also grown in nations like Brazil and India.

What is the Future of E-sports In India?

According to estimates, there are more than 300 million players in India. The interest in competitive video games like PlayerUnknown’s Battlegrounds Mobile (PUBG Mobile), FreeFire, Valorant, and multiplayer competitions has surpassed laid-back games. 

Investments in eSports in India have also increased massively. According to the Investment Intelligence Study, venture capital companies have invested more than $438 million in Indian gaming businesses since 2021. In Fiscal Year (FY) 2020, the value of all eSports startups in India was $68 million. The Federation of Electronic Sports Associations of India (FEAI) forecasts that the Indian eSports industry will reach a value of over Rs 1100 core by FY25.

Virtual Reality

Virtual reality has been promising gamers an immersive environment for years. However, the technology has taken a while to fulfill that promise. Ben Kuchera of Polygon said it better: “VR has been roughly eight years away from some form of breakthrough.” Although virtual reality hasn’t fulfilled its promises, internet giants like Facebook and Sony are attempting to progress by creating VR devices and games. The future of virtual reality promises to be better.
